CITRONELLOL

Ingredient type:ALLERGEN

Regulated allergen

✨ Role: Citronellol is a fragrance compound often used to add a floral and fresh scent to cosmetic products. It may also have antimicrobial properties.

Ingredient type: Fragrance

‍⚕️ Safety: Generally safe. However, it may cause sensitization in some individuals, particularly with repeated exposure.

✨ Vegan: Yes, citronellol is typically plant-based.

✨ Note: Citronellol may cause allergic reactions in sensitive individuals, especially those with reactive skin or known allergies to fragrances. It is designated as a potential allergen in the European Union and must be listed on labels when present above certain thresholds.

Found in: Perfumes, lotions, creams, deodorants, bath products, and shower gels.
